Chive-and-Garlic Knots
- 1 1/2 tablespoons butter or stick margarine
- 2 garlic cloves, minced
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 (11-ounce) can refrigerated French bread dough
- 2 tablespoons chopped fresh chives or green onions
- 2 tablespoons grated Parmesan cheese
- cooking spray
- Melt butter in a small skillet over medium heat.
- Add minced garlic; saute 30 seconds or until lightly browned.
- Remove from heat; stir in garlic powder.
- Unroll the French bread dough onto a lightly floured surface; brush dough with garlic mixture.
- Sprinkle the dough with chives and cheese.
- Cut the dough crosswise into 12 strips.
- Shape each strip into a knot.
- Place the knots onto a baking sheet coated with cooking spray.
- Bake at 350 degrees for 17 minutes or until lightly browned.
- Serve warm.
- CALORIES 81 (29 percent from fat); FAT 2.6g (sat 1.3g, mono 0.8g, poly 0.4g); PROTEIN 2.5g; CARB 11.6g; FIBER 0g; CHOL 5mg; IRON 0.6mg; SODIUM 185mg; CALC 13mg
